Neil Douglas passed away peacefully on Sunday, March 30, 2025 surrounded by family. Neil was born on October 6, 1942 in South Bend, to the late William Kuhns and Catherine (Johnson) (Joseph) Herter.
Neil is survived by his loving partner of 42 years, Gayle Cossman: children, Keith, Dacia, Jesse Copeland and Douglas Kuhns; six grandchildren: Kory Howe, Antonio Mendoza, Jerome (Marissa) Copeland Sr., Trezden Copeland, Kaiden Kuhns and Liliana Dixon; six great-grandchildren; sisters, Catherine Kramer and Sue (Terry) Gantt; and brother, Vernon (Vickie) Herter.
Neil graduated from Eau Claire High School and then attended Marquette University.
Entertaining was Neil’s passion, whether it be music or using his gift of gab. He was a talented singer, song writer and musician, playing the keyboard or guitar with his band. He also traveled on the road fronting for several artists in the 60’s.
In the early 90’s, Neil combined his talent for talk and interest in politics to host Power Talk and Stand Up America on WAMJ 1580 talk radio.
Later in life, Neil helped many seniors with their healthcare needs as an agent with GE Financial and United Health Care.
Neil left an impression on everyone he met and will be greatly missed.
